Masonry Drainage System BLOCKFLASH BOND BEAM DETAIL download:DWG view:PDF WebMay 16, 2024 · Concrete blocks, also known as Concrete Masonry Units or CMUs, provide very durable structural and non-structural partitions. They are generally used as a backup wall that gets covered with a finish material or exposed in utilitarian spaces like mechanical rooms or basements.

WebA sill plate or sole plate in construction and architecture is the bottom horizontal member of a wall or building to which vertical members are attached.
